A vocal performance for the ages!

1/2" / 15 IPS / Dolby SR analog master to DSD 64 to analog console to lathe

Spinning majestic webs of mellow atmosphere woven with rhythmic textures

True to its title, Tigerlily balance fierceness and delicacy, creating a rare span of emotional territory. Listening to Tigerlily, a distinct songwriter's voice emerges, one which possesses strength and vulnerability. The lyrics are personal, the arrangements stark and sparse. Tigerlily was engineered by John Holbrook, who has worked with The Band, Peter Tosh, and the Isley Brothers.
